The Steering Committee of the IEEE Conference on AI is now inviting interested organizers to submit proposals to organize the 2028 (Singapore) and 2029 (Silicon Valley) editions of the IEEE Conference on Artificial Intelligence (CAI). CAI is a premier global forum and exhibition bridging academic breakthroughs with industrial relevance, showcasing actionable AI applications, fostering cross-sector collaboration, and maintaining rigorous technical standards. 

IEEE CAI serves as a hub for AI leaders and innovators from industry, government, startups, and academia. Attendees have the opportunity to engage directly with researchers, experts, and solution providers to gain inspiration, explore cutting-edge solutions, and exchange impactful ideas. The conference consistently attracts over 500 attendees and receives over 600 paper submissions each year.

This conference is a collaborative initiative jointly sponsored by IEEE and four of its Societies: the Computational Intelligence Society (CIS), the Computer Society (CS), the Systems, Man, and Cybernetics Society (SMC), and the Signal Processing Society (SPS).

To simplify the planning process, host location proposals are not required for this invitation. The dates, venues, and regional logistics for IEEE CAI 2028 and 2029 are already coordinated, as the events will take place concurrently with the IEEE Signal Processing Summit (SP Summit).

To submit a proposal, please complete and submit the following materials to this form by 30 September 2026.

  1. Detailed proposal as outlined within the guidelines
  2. Organizing Committee List
  3. Organizer CVs

Please note that submission of a proposal confirms that the organizing teams have reviewed and agreed to the SPS Conference Organizer Guidelines and all terms and conditions.

Proposals will be evaluated by the IEEE CAI Steering Committee and sponsoring societies to select the final candidates. Finalists will be invited to present to the Steering Committee in a virtual meeting between 26 October 2026 - 6 November 2026.
